Aalborg Triathlon takes place in June in Aalborg's west end, centered at Nordens Kridtgrav, a tranquil chalk pit for the swim. The event features a Classic quarter ironman and a half ironman. The half distance is available for individual competitors or relay teams. The quarter distance suits both novice triathletes and seasoned racers, while the half ironman employs age-group racing, allowing athletes to compete against others in their age bracket and vie for category wins.
The swim occurs within the sheltered chalk pit. The 45 km bike course includes ascents, technical segments, and flat sections for faster riding. The run course is situated between the race track and Nordens Kridtgrav. Half-ironman relay teams can divide the swim, bike, and run among two or three participants, competing in men's, women's, or mixed categories. Palle and Martin are the organizers for this eighth edition, which is one of Denmark's significant triathlon events. The race day includes water safety personnel, traffic officials, flag marshals, support staff, medical professionals, nutritional provisions, and a post-race meal.
